SA Firefighters responding to USA request for help

30/07/2018

 

The South Australian Country Fire Service (CFS), along with the Metropolitan Fire Service (MFS), State Emergency Service (SES) and Department for Environment and Water (DEW), are currently considering their capacity to help supply specialists to support firefighters in the USA.

Over the weekend the National Multi-Agency Coordination (MAC) Group in the USA requested Australia and New Zealand's help with wildfires in the USA.

Currently 89 large fires have burned more than 376,000 hectares in 14 states in north western USA.

MAC has requested the assistance of 188 specialist firefighters from Australia and New Zealand.

Firefighters would be required for a 20 - 42 day deployment in the California area.

Any SA candidates will be placed in a national pool, with the most suitable candidates being announced late tomorrow afternoon, and deployed to the USA on Friday.
